### TKT-482: Signature check failed on Timetabler build 3.2.1

The Scholaris timetable solver failed signature verification during Thursday's staging deploy. Investigation shows the build was signed before last month's rotation, so the verifier rejected it as stale. Rebuild is queued. For the sync: please confirm everyone's tooling references the current key, shown below.

deploy key for kajof-fajop: bky6_gDHw9Q

## Runbook: Coalhopper Alert Deduplicator

Coalhopper sits between the monitoring pipeline and the paging system, collapsing duplicate alerts within a five-minute window. If on-call reports alert storms, first check Coalhopper's dedup queue depth and drop rate. Restarting the service flushes its window state, so expect one burst of duplicates immediately after. Queue inspection and manual flushes go through the admin endpoint, which requires authentication. The admin API key is:

app token of bahaf-tajeg = zpat23_SjjsllwiLmXbtS65veZaV47

## Template rendering performance

The Lanternfold render service compiles customer templates once and caches the bytecode per tenant. Most latency pages trace back to cache evictions after a config push, not slow templates themselves. If p95 render time exceeds 300ms, check the compile-cache hit rate first; below 90% means a cold cache, which self-heals in about ten minutes. Manual cache warming is available but rarely needed. Dashboards, thresholds, and the warming procedure are documented here.

runbook for badug-kadup: https://confluence.zemvarlabs.internal/projects/browse/display/projects/bd1b